Primary Responsibilities:
Authorization Coordination: Facilitate the timely approval of spine surgery procedures by liaising with insurance companies, healthcare providers, and patients
Documentation Management: Maintain accurate records of authorization requests, approvals, and denials, ensuring compliance with regulatory standards
Insurance Verification: Verify patients' insurance coverage and benefits related to spine surgery procedures to ensure accurate billing and reimbursement
Patient Advocacy: Serve as a point of contact for patients, providing guidance and support throughout the authorization process and addressing any concerns or inquiries
Communication: Collaborate with healthcare professionals, including surgeons, nurses, and administrative staff, to ensure seamless coordination of authorization-related tasks
Problem Resolution: Proactively identify and resolve issues related to authorization delays, denials, or discrepancies, advocating for patients' access to necessary spine surgery services
Adherence to Policies: Adhere to organizational policies and procedures regarding authorization processes, confidentiality, and patient rights
Continuous Improvement: Participate in ongoing training and professional development activities to stay updated on industry trends, regulations, and best practices in authorization management
